Tips for purchasing a new EV amid a vehicle shortage

Plug in America

Global supply chain challenges continue to limit the production of new vehicles. High demand/brand new models such as the BMW i4, Ford Mustang Mach-E, and Hyundai IONIQ 5 are in extremely high demand and short supply on dealership lots. Navigant Research forecasts new EV global sales of > 346,000 units in 2014; 10 predictions for the year

Green Car Congress

During 2014, the global plug-in electric vehicle (PEV) industry is poised to grow by 86% and will surpass more than 346,000 new vehicles sold, according to a new white paper—“ Electric Vehicles: 10 Predictions for 2014 ”—published by Navigant Research. More mainstream models will come from Kia, Mahindra, Škoda, and Volkswagen.

KPMG survey finds global auto execs ranking fuel efficiency the top consumer priority

Green Car Congress

Fuel efficiency, safety innovation, and vehicle styling will be the three most important product issues influencing automotive consumer purchase decisions over the next five years, indicating a perceived shift in buying priorities, according to the 12 th annual global automotive survey conducted by KPMG LLP.

India becomes South Africa’s top country for vehicle imports

Baua Electric

Read more Various brands have helped establish India as the global hub for small and entry-level vehicles, segments which comprise the bulk of sales in the South African domestic market. Tata and Mahindra have established a strong presence, while China has become the second largest importer.

Major automakers, startups, technology companies and others launch Mobility Open Blockchain Initiative (MOBI)

Green Car Congress

Early in May major automakers, startups, technology companies and others came together to launch, MOBI, the Mobility Open Blockchain Initiative, to explore blockchain for use in a new digital mobility ecosystem that could make transportation safer, more affordable, and more widely accessible.
